WebAs the name BFS suggests, you are required to traverse the graph breadthwise as follows: First move horizontally and visit all the nodes of the current layer. Move to the next layer. Consider the following diagram. … WebMar 24, 2024 · Binary search trees (BST) are a variation of the binary tree and are widely used in the software field. They are also called ordered binary trees as each node in BST is placed according to a specific order. Inorder traversal of BST gives us the sorted sequence of items in ascending order.
Data Structure - Binary Search Tree - TutorialsPoint
WebAug 3, 2024 · In this tutorial, we’ll be discussing the Binary Search Tree Data Structure. We’ll be implementing the functions to search, insert and remove values from a Binary … WebJan 3, 2011 · My question is this - is there a way to design an iterator over a binary search tree with the following properties? Elements are visited in ascending order (i.e. an inorder traversal) next () and hasNext () queries run in O (1) time. Memory usage is O (1) blood test labs in newmarket
[HIMTI TUTOR] Data Structures - Binary Search Tree - YouTube
WebDec 4, 2024 · Approach: In inorder traversal, the tree is traversed in this way: left, root, right. The algorithm approach can be stated as: We first recursively visit the left child and go on till we find a leaf node. Then we print that node value. Then we … WebFeb 19, 2024 · Since the inorder traversal of Binary Search Tree is a sorted array. The node with the smallest key greater than the given node is defined as its inorder successor. In a BST, there are two possibilities for the inorder successor, the node with the least value in the node’s right subtree or ancestor. WebAug 1, 2024 · Inorder Traversal: Below is the idea to solve the problem: At first traverse left subtree then visit the root and then traverse the right subtree. Follow the below steps to implement the idea: Traverse left subtree. Visit the root and print the data. Traverse … free digital download scrapbook paper